Making Your Business Profitable With More Shipping Options

Before the Internet, your choices for shipping were limited.
Pricing was pretty well fixed unless you were doing a lot of
business with a specific company and most people bought
products locally to keep costs down. With the arrival of the
Internet shipping has become BIG business which translates
into major savings for everyone from the everyday consumer,
to billion dollar companies, and everybody else in between.

Now the average person can go online and buy most things and
receive wholesale pricing. This has created a swell of
interest within the companies, and organizations that are
responsible for shipping. What this has done is create a
ripple effect in lower and more affordable shipping
costs. It's been a real boon for the "work at home"
businesses, because the shipping playing field has been
evened out and now they are able to compete.

Whether you are sending a package to a friend, or you are
responsible for shipping at your firm, then you will
realize how important it is to find good pricing on your
shipping needs, including the supplies. For some people
shipping has become a common everyday occurence like grocery
buying. Most major shipping companies now have online
services. You can also find local and discount shipping when
you search the net because you can easily compare prices and
customer service with a simple keystroke.

Here are a couple of things to keep in mind when shipping an
item. The quality of shipping boxes is an important factor.
Shipping boxes can come in many dimensions and prices. Don't
just look for cheap boxes because while this may be good
short term, it can turn disastrous when the items arrive at
their destination damaged. If you use good shipping boxes
and pack with care, your shipment will most likely arrive on
time and in one piece. It is important to use the correct
shipping boxes for each item in order to provide maximum
protection during the shipping process. Spending a little
extra on the front end will payoff in the long run.

When you are searching for shipping boxes, check out the
great deals on bubble wrap, packing tape, newsprint and
packing peanuts. Whether you have a home based business, or
are running the shipping department at your company, your
reputation is on the line when it comes to getting your
product into the customer's hands. There's no need to go
cheap on the materials. Your recipient will appreciate you
taking the time, and spending a little extra money to make
sure that their items arrive at their door safely.

Last but not least, shop around for a reliable shipping
company. Just a few years ago, there were only a handful of
choices to pick from. Now there is a growing number of
companies competing for your shipping business. This has
driven shipping costs down even lower, and brought customer
service up to higher levels. The internet has opened up the
whole world as a marketplace.Companies like UPS, FedEx, DHL,
and the USPS are all stepping up to the plate to meet the
greater demand for user friendly shipping. The other side of
the story is that it looks like there is no end in sight.
It's great news for the manufacturers and consumers alike.
